Modern Precision Irrigation Sprinklers
Optimizing water use is essential for sustainable agriculture and responsible landscaping. Leveraging precision irrigation sprinklers presents a powerful solution to achieve this goal. These advanced systems provide water directly to plant roots, reducing water waste and improving crop yields.
Precision irrigation sprinklers often feature sensors and controllers that monitor soil moisture levels and weather conditions. This real-time data facilitates the system to automatically adjust watering schedules and check here deliver the precise amount of water essential.
- Additionally, precision irrigation sprinklers can be tailored to accommodate the specific needs of different crops or plant varieties. This level of customization guarantees optimal water delivery for each plant type.
- Consequently, the use of precision irrigation sprinklers results in several gains, including water conservation, cost savings, increased crop production, and improved soil health.
Preserve Your Irrigation Sprinklers in Tip-Top Shape
To guarantee the longevity of your irrigation sprinklers, scheduled maintenance is key. Start by inspecting your sprinkler system at least once a month for any signs of damage or leaks. Meticulously wash the sprinkler heads with a tool to remove debris and mineral buildup. Evaluate using a gentle cleaning solution if necessary. Ensure that all sprinkler heads are aligned correctly to distribute water evenly across your lawn.
- Examine the pressure valve occasionally to ensure optimal water pressure.
- Drain your sprinkler system in the fall to prevent freeze damage during winter months.
- Consult a professional irrigation specialist for any repairs or maintenance tasks you are afraid to handle yourself.
